1. SOLENOID UNIT 1. Remove the select lever with the select cable connected. Select Lever > REMOVAL 2. Remove the spacer and gasket. Select Lever > REMOVAL 3. Remove the harness connector from the select lever COMPL.
4. Remove the harness from the select lever COMPL.
5. Raise the claw using a flat tip screwdriver with a thin tip, and remove the solenoid unit from the select lever COMPL.
6. Remove the terminal of the solenoid unit using a flat tip precision screwdriver with a tip width of 1.3 mm (0.05 in) or less, KTC connector terminal tool ECC-1T or equivalent.
2. “P” RANGE SWITCH The “P” range switch cannot be removed as a single unit. Therefore, replace the AT select lever COMPL. Select Lever > REMOVAL |
